The work we do is underpinned by quality. We deliver audits which are trusted and transparent which can be relied upon by companies and their stakeholders. You'll help deliver accurate and transparent reporting to all relevant stakeholders as you provide long term value.
- ACA/ACCA/ICAS qualified or overseas equivalent.
- Experience supervising and coaching junior members of staff on site.
- Working knowledge of UK and International GAAS, IFRS, UK GAAP and Financial Reporting requirements.
- Working knowledge of firm services, issues regarding advice, and regulation and compliance, including anti-money laundering.

How to prepare for a job interview at BDO UK
✨Know Your Numbers
Brush up on your knowledge of UK and International GAAS, IFRS, and UK GAAP. Be prepared to discuss how these standards apply to real-world scenarios, as this will show your understanding of the audit landscape and your ability to navigate complex financial reporting requirements.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Since the role involves supervising and coaching junior staff, think of examples from your past experiences where you successfully led a team or mentored someone. Highlighting these moments will demonstrate your capability to guide others and contribute to a collaborative work environment.
